Gold Retreats from Record on Thursday, Dec. 28

Three of four major precious metals declined on Thursday, including gold which fell for the first time in five sessions and from an all-time high.

Gold for February delivery fell by $9.60, or 0.5%, to settle at $2,083.50 an ounce on the Comex division of the New York Mercantile Exchange.

"There’s not a lot of trading volume right now in any of the markets so that usually causes smaller moves, especially when we’re approaching a big number like an all-time high," Reuters quoted Chris Gaffney, president of world markets at EverBank.

"The reason prices have gone back near the horizon and rallied again towards the end of the year is all about interest rate expectations and a weaker dollar."

Gold futures traded between $2,078.50 and $2,098.20. They advanced by 1.1% on Wednesday, registering a record settlement at $2,093.10 an ounce, and they inched 0.03% higher at the start of the new trading week on Tuesday.

Declining for the fourth time in five sessions, silver for March delivery gave back 26.9 cents, or 1.1%, ending at $24.372 an ounce. Silver futures ranged from $24.25 to $24.74. They gained 1% on Wednesday and they lost 0.7% on Tuesday.

In other precious metals prices on Thursday:

  • April platinum added $8.60, or 0.9%, to $1,023.20 an ounce, trading between $1,009.10 and $1,031.

  • Palladium for March delivery declined by $17.50, or 1.5%, to $1,140.20 an ounce, ranging from $1,132 to $1,175.

US Mint Bullion Sales in 2023

On Thursday, the U.S. Mint published new bullion sales, marking only the second time this month. The data showed increases in American Eagle gold and silver coin sales, and it included a negative adjustment for American Buffalo gold coins.

The table below presents a breakdown of U.S. Mint bullion products sold, with columns indicating the number of coins sold (not total ounces) during different time periods.
